One way to narrow your list would be whether there are direct flights from Chicago to the new area. It doesn't seem like a big deal until traveling back to Chicago involves a 8 hours of driving, waiting, flying, waiting, and flying. Another thing important to me is how friendly the people are. It's absolutely dreadful when you move to a city where people are not friendly and unwilling to talk.

Sorry, I can't help with art career advice.

But I do have to say to remember that moving away doesn't always bring you to the promise land. You wake up in the new city the same person, just with fewer familiar face for the first couple years.
